Troy, I really can't help with diagnosing. CFS? Fibromalgia? A strain of flu? Something like glandular fever? A combination? No idea. But it sounds like you need more than a forum and you need RL help, forums can be useful but they cannot in any way replace proper medical treatment.

Your doctor is not responding well to you, it certainly sounds like you have cause for some investigation and thought to be put into solving the mystery. Ask around about a better doctor and go and see them ASAP. Type up a concise, orderly list of your symptoms together and print it in a clear fashion and give it to the doctor. That way if you don't have the energy to "present well" (as I doubt you currently do, possibly encouraging an easy diagnosis of "stress") you have something else to fall back on: go through the list with them.

Really, this is the sort of thing I think you need to be doing as a positive next step. See another doctor if the second doesn't take you seriously. Good luck and I hope you find relief.
